What to check before for buildings with elevators near the M103 bus in NYC
- Use the elevator filter to confirm access for your move-in needs; ask how often the elevator is out of service and whether it supports your desired floor.
- Check the building’s current advertised availability (timing varies) and compare lease terms, move-in requirements, and any waiting periods.
- Before applying, confirm your unit’s exact location (stairs vs. elevator path), laundry access, and package delivery process.
- If the elevator is shared with commercial space or has separate hours, clarify how that affects your day-to-day routine.
- Review fees and costs beyond rent (security deposit, possible broker/administrative fees, and utility responsibilities) before you commit.
